Head coach of Argentina, Lionel Scaloni has urged Lionel Messi to continue playing for “as long as he can”.

Advertisement

Messi is yet to officially confirm when he will hang up his boots.

The 36-year-old recently completed his first season with MLS side Inter Miami CF and is preparing for his second year in the US. “We tell him [Messi] to play for as long as he can. “We tell him [Messi] to play for as long as he can.

Advertisement

“He has proved that he doesn’t have an end. You don’t know when he will give [it] up. It’s incredible,” Scaloni told Christian Vieri in a Twitch interview.

Messi finally won the World Cup playing under Scaloni at Qatar and has now lifted every possible trophy during his illustrious career.
